A few days ago, the manganese-silicon alloy factory carried out a successful sintering test on the backlog of dedusting dust.
The dust dust produced in the manganese-silicon smelting process has a manganese content of about 17%. In the past, it was added to the manganese ore according to the mixing ratio of 5%, and the remaining 95% was piled up, which is a hidden danger of raising dust and environmental protection. For this reason, the factory held a special meeting to work out the experimental scheme of dust removal and sintering. The technician successfully sintered the dedusting ash sinter by adjusting many parameters such as the proportion of water, blue carbon powder and sintering temperature. The manganese content in the mine is 26%-29%, and the iron content is 1.7%-1.9%. The particle size and strength meet the requirements of manganese silicon smelting. Up to now, 565 tons of dust dust sinter has been used in production.
With the success of the test, the difficult problem of solid waste disposal is solved, the risk of environmental protection and ore consumption are reduced, and the maximum benefit of recycling is realized.
